On my double page spread I used Photoshop to cut out the
background of the main image so that when I placed it onto
InDesign I could use the space behind it. I used a lot of different
technics on InDesign for my double page spread I focused a lot
on how I were to flow the text around the pull quotes, I did this
by using text wrap, when I first done this I found that some of
my text was closer to the pull quote on one side then it was the
other so I clicked on this and increased the distance of spacing
to how far the text wrap was to the text. I also imbedded
pictures using InDesign o my double page spread.
